At Red Bank Veterinary Hospitals, we are frequently asked about the costs of an office call. Charges vary based on the type of visit; please ask for specifics when you make your pet’s appointment.

Please note: Appointments are never required for emergency visits. At the time of such visits, the emergency department staff reviews all necessary services, options, and costs with you.

To give you a better sense of the costs involved in treating your pet’s medical condition, your veterinarian will develop a health care plan. This plan includes an approximate range of charges that may be incurred for services and procedures while your pet is hospitalized.

While our hospital does not offer in-house payment plans, we do accept the following forms of payment:

CareCredit

Red Bank Veterinary Hospitals accepts CareCredit. CareCredit is a healthcare credit card designed for the health and wellness needs of you, your family, and your pets. It helps you pay for out-of-pocket expenses not covered by medical insurance by extending special financing options to qualified *applicants.

Pet Insurance

While we still require you to pay your medical bill directly to Red Bank Veterinary Hospitals, we are happy to help with any of the necessary paperwork that will streamline the reimbursement process from your insurance provider.
